Factors to Consider When Selecting a Solid State Relay


When it comes to selecting a solid state relay (SSR), there are several important factors to consider. A solid state relay is an electronic switching device that uses semiconductor technology to control the flow of electrical current. Unlike traditional electromechanical relays, SSRs have no moving parts, making them more reliable and durable. However, choosing the right SSR for your application requires careful consideration of a few key factors.

First and foremost, it is crucial to determine the voltage and current requirements of your application. SSRs come in various voltage and current ratings, and selecting one that can handle the specific demands of your system is essential for optimal performance and safety. Additionally, consider the load type (AC or DC) and the maximum switching frequency required for your application.

Next, you should evaluate the SSR's input and output specifications. The input voltage range determines the control signal compatibility, so make sure it aligns with your control circuitry. The output configuration, whether it is normally open (NO) or normally closed (NC), depends on your system's needs. Additionally, check the maximum load current and voltage rating of the SSR's output to ensure compatibility with your load.

Another crucial factor to consider is the SSR's heat dissipation capability. SSRs generate heat during operation, and if not properly managed, it can lead to premature failure or reduced lifespan. Look for SSRs with built-in heat sinks or thermal pads to dissipate heat effectively. Additionally, consider the ambient temperature in which the SSR will operate and ensure it falls within the specified operating temperature range.

Reliability and longevity are also important considerations. Look for SSRs from reputable manufacturers with a proven track record of producing high-quality products. Read customer reviews and testimonials to gauge the reliability and durability of the SSR you are considering. Additionally, check if the SSR has any certifications or compliance with industry standards to ensure its reliability and safety.

Lastly, consider the cost-effectiveness of the SSR. While it may be tempting to opt for the cheapest option, it is important to strike a balance between quality and cost. Consider the long-term benefits and potential savings in terms of maintenance, energy efficiency, and overall system performance when making your decision.
